SA20 2025-26 Match 20: JSK vs MICT head-to-head, pitch report & predicted playing XIs
Joburg Super Kings face struggling MI Cape Town in a crucial SA20 clash at the Wanderers.

Joburg Super Kings will face MI Cape Town in Match 20 of the SA20 2025-26 at the Wanderers Stadium in Johannesburg on Saturday, January 10. This will be their second meeting this season, and MI Cape Town had won the earlier match.
The Joburg Super Kings are sitting second on the points table. They have won three matches so far, while two of their games were washed out due to rain. Despite these interruptions, JSK have looked steady and balanced as a team. Playing at home, they'd want to come back strong and settle the scores with the MI Cape Town.
The MI Cape Town are not doing well in the season, with only one win so far that keeps them at the bottom of the table. Things have not gone their way so far, but there is still quality in the squad. A win here could give them just the confidence they need and keep their hopes alive.
JSK vs MICT: Head-to-Head Record (T20s)
- Matches Played: 7
- MI Cape Town Won: 4
- Joburg Super Kings Won: 3
- No Result: 0
JSK vs MICT: Pitch Report
The Wanderers' pitch is known to be very good for batting. The ball comes nicely onto the bat, and if well-timed, the players can score quite quickly. There is good bounce that assists stroke play. Bowlers must be accurate, as any loose delivery can go for runs.
